Lightbulb there are many things

that happen with the feet. You could have tendonitis,
arthritis, or tarsal tunnel (when the ligament around the ankle is too tight and compresses nerves).

One should always have a good podiatrist check for other issues.
There are many more that can cause problems.

And don't tie yours shoes too tight!
And don't wear tight socks. There are relaxed fit types now
at WalMart. Tight socks compress the nerves at the ankles.
